Method
Preparation of Creole Butter
- 1
Make the Creole Butter
In a medium bowl, combine the softened unsalted butter, minced garlic, creole seasoning, lemon juice, chopped parsley, and hot sauce. Mix thoroughly until all ingredients are well incorporated. Set aside.
Preparing the Oysters
- 2
Clean the Oysters
Rinse the fresh oysters under cold water to remove any grit or debris. Using a clean cloth, scrub the shells of the oysters to ensure they are clean.
- 3
Shuck the Oysters
Using an oyster knife, carefully shuck each oyster, being cautious of the sharp edges. Place the shucked oysters on a baking tray with the cupped side facing down.
Grilling
- 4
Preheat the Grill
Preheat your grill to high heat. If using charcoal, allow the coals to become ashen, or if using gas, heat it on high for about 10-15 minutes.
- 5
Add Creole Butter
Spoon a generous amount of the prepared Creole butter onto each shucked oyster.
